Overview

Extruded Polyether Ether Ketone (PEEK) is a high-performance thermoplastic known for its exceptional mechanical, thermal, and chemical resistance properties. It is widely used in demanding industries such as aerospace, automotive, and medical due to its ability to withstand extreme conditions. PEEK is produced through an extrusion process, resulting in semi-crystalline pellets or rods that can be further processed into various forms. PEEK's unique combination of properties makes it a preferred material for applications requiring durability and reliability. Its biocompatibility also allows for use in medical implants and devices, further expanding its utility across multiple sectors.

Physical and Chemical Properties

Extruded PEEK exhibits a density of 1.32 g/cm³ and a melting point of 343°C, making it suitable for high-temperature applications. It retains its mechanical strength even at elevated temperatures, with a continuous service temperature of up to 250°C. The material is also highly resistant to chemicals, including acids, bases, and organic solvents. PEEK's semi-crystalline structure contributes to its excellent dimensional stability and low moisture absorption. These properties ensure consistent performance in humid or wet environments, making it ideal for use in harsh conditions. Additionally, PEEK has good electrical insulation properties, further broadening its application scope.

Main Applications

Extruded PEEK is extensively used in the aerospace industry for components such as bushings, seals, and bearings, where its lightweight and high-strength properties are critical. In the automotive sector, it is employed in under-the-hood parts, including sensors and connectors, due to its heat and chemical resistance. The medical industry benefits from PEEK's biocompatibility, using it for spinal implants, dental devices, and surgical instruments. Its electrical insulation properties also make it suitable for wire coatings and connectors in the electronics industry. PEEK's versatility ensures its presence in a wide range of high-performance applications.

Safety and Storage

While PEEK is generally safe to handle, precautions should be taken when processing it at high temperatures, as it may emit fumes. Proper ventilation and personal protective equipment (PPE) are recommended during machining or molding operations. The material is non-toxic and biocompatible, making it safe for medical applications. Storage of extruded PEEK should be in a dry, cool environment away from direct sunlight and moisture to prevent degradation. Proper packaging, such as sealed bags or containers, is essential to maintain material quality. Long-term storage under optimal conditions ensures the material retains its properties for future use.

B2B Procurement Guide

When procuring extruded PEEK, it is crucial to verify the material grade and supplier certifications to ensure compliance with industry standards. Application-specific requirements, such as thermal or mechanical performance, should be clearly communicated to the supplier. Bulk purchases may offer cost advantages, but quality should never be compromised. Lead times and minimum order quantities (MOQs) vary among suppliers, so planning ahead is advisable. Additionally, consider the supplier's technical support and post-sale services, as these can be invaluable for troubleshooting or custom applications. Always request material test reports (MTRs) to confirm the properties of the supplied PEEK.
